KTextEditor
#include <factory.h>
Inherits Factory.
Public Member Functions | |
Factory (QObject *parent) | |
virtual | ~Factory () |
virtual Editor * | editor ()=0 |
Detailed Description
Accessor to the Editor implementation.
Topics:
Introduction
The Factory provides access to the chosen Editor (selected with KTextEditor::EditorChooser). The Editor itself then provides methods to handle documents and config options.
To access the Editor use editor().
Each KTextEditor implementation must reimplement this factory to allow access to the editor object.
Creating an Editor Part
To get a kate part the following code snippet can be used:
If another editor part is desired substitue the string "katepart" with the corresponding library name.
However, if you are only interested in getting the editor part (which is usually the case) a simple call of
is enough.
Notes
It is recommend to use the EditorChooser to get the used editor part. This way the user can choose the editor implementation. The Factory itself is not needed to get the Editor with the help of the EditorChooser.
- See also
- KParts::Factory, KTextEditor::Editor
Constructor & Destructor Documentation
Factory::Factory | ( | QObject * | parent | ) |
Constructor.
Create a new Factory with parent
.
- Parameters
-
parent parent object
Definition at line 67 of file ktexteditor.cpp.
|
virtual |
Virtual destructor.
Definition at line 73 of file ktexteditor.cpp.
Member Function Documentation
|
pure virtual |
Get the global Editor object.
The editor part implementation must ensure that this object lives as long as any factory or document object exists.
- Returns
- global KTextEditor::Editor object
The documentation for this class was generated from the following files:
Documentation copyright © 1996-2020 The KDE developers.
Generated on Sat May 9 2020 03:56:48 by doxygen 1.8.7 written by Dimitri van Heesch, © 1997-2006
KDE's Doxygen guidelines are available online.